Installation Overview
Installing the 280360 involves standard shock absorber replacement procedures. Key steps include:
- Secure the vehicle on a lift or jack stands to ensure safety.
- Remove the existing shock absorber using appropriate tools.
- Align the new unit with mounting brackets, ensuring proper orientation of the gas port.
- Torque all fasteners to manufacturer specifications to maintain seal integrity.
- Perform a post‑installation alignment check to verify suspension geometry.
Maintenance Tips
While the 280360 is designed for long service life, routine checks can extend its performance:
- Inspect for oil leaks around the mounting points and valve seals.
- Verify that the gas port remains sealed; any breach may alter damping behavior.
- Check for physical damage to the shock body or spring assembly.
